Suggested Listening: Arbouretum’s “Song Of The Pearl”

It’s taken me a little while to fully grasp what exactly I was listening to when I first tried out Baltimore band Arbouretum’s new Thrill Jockey release Song Of The Pearl.  I have always been interested in their sound from afar – dabbling in a song or two – but never quite latching on.  Song Of The Pearl caught me on the right rainy night when my emotions had worn down…the slow rumble of Dave Heumann voice lurking beneath wild thunderous guitars and blues thrash drums perked my ears and drew me in.  Somehow Dylan and Young merged with Zeppelin and Floyd who melted with Black Sabbath and Danzig.  Doom folk is the genre Arbouretum, but sometimes it’s more like folk folk doom or doom doom folk or doom doom rock…you get the idea.  Song Of The Pearl is that nuanced – flowing from one extreme to the next.  I couldn’t ask for more.
